San Art is pleased to announce the opening of “Black Paintings” by Nguyen Thai Tuan, whose works render the human body monochromatic and void of any individuality, save for the clothing that fashion the near insubstantial, ethereal forms
You are cordially invited to the opening reception on Thursday, May 15, 2008, at 6:00 p.m. 23 Ly Tu Trong Street, District 1, Ho Chi Minh City
Exhibition continues through June 14, 2008
The exquisitely fashioned figures of Nguyen Thai Tuan appear ethereal and wraithlike, their insubstantial forms mirroring a monochromatic landscape that is featureless and indistinguishable. 'Black Paintings' is a series of oil paintings where the human form is given meaning by its absence. The body of an invisible man is clothed and seated on a forlorn seat amongst a swath of yellow. In another image, three women in white stare at the viewer, seated and dressed in contemporary attire, their individual features lost, blacked in. This omission of human detail, masked in a color suggesting darkness, ignorance or emptiness is a deliberate ploy by the artist. He calls into question how we identify with the world, through the media, fashion, popular and political trends, by understanding how these systems may perpetuate ideas of cultural stereotypes and assumptions. By confronting such ideas, perhaps these black forms can be transformed into a different kind of human truth.
